WSN Life Time Maximization using Virtual Backbone and ERPMT Techniques
Journal Title: International Journal of Engineering Sciences & Research Technology - Year 30, Vol 2, Issue 6
Abstract
Our project aim is to increase the lifetime of Wireless sensor network using Virtual Backbone Scheduling and ERPMT method. In VBS Method Instead of creating a single backbone we are creating a Multiple overlapped backbones to work alternatively. This would increase the lifetime of WSN comparably. In ERPMT Method we divide the node energy into two ratios; one for the sensor node originated data and the other one is data relays from other sensors. Our proposed technique is evaluated by using the simulator NS2. The simulation results show that the life time of the network increases at the same time it provides highest system throughput. The performance is evaluated by considering the QoS parameters like data rate, packet loss ratio, Bandwidth, SNR value.
